Session
Boosting developer effectiveness with a Java platform team
Maintaining a high-quality and uniform codebase poses significant challenges at scale, as ever-growing technical debt, inconsistencies, and weak dependency management slip in too easily. This talk delves into how a dedicated Java Platform can tackle all these challenges by providing a centralized solution!
Picnic's Java Platform approach empowers a community of 300+ developers with a robust suite of tools and shared libraries. Instead of teams having to reinvent the wheel, developers can use out-of-the-box libraries for cross-cutting concerns such as logging, observability and security. This facilitates adherence to guidelines and enforces best practices. As a result, developers can sidestep the burden of creating repetitive and mundane implementations and focus on writing actual business logic.
Learn how to harness the power of automation to achieve consistency and standardization with continuous enhancement. We will discuss our tooling setup and practices. Gain insights into an approach of providing shared libraries, centralized Maven configuration, developer tools, and CI/CD practices. Come and learn how Picnic's developers are empowered to build Java services with efficiency, quality, and confidence.

Rick Ossendrijver
Software Engineer in Picnic's Java Platform team
Utrecht, The Netherlands
Links
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.
Jump to top